Easy Ground Beef Taco Bowls

Easy Ground Beef Taco Bowls

This delicious recipe for Easy Ground Beef Taco Bowls is perfect for a quick weeknight dinner, packed with savory flavors and topped with your favorite fixings!

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es
Servings: 4
Calories: 120kcal

Ingredients
 

Main Ingredients

  • 1.5 lb ground beef Use lean beef for a healthier option.
  • 1 medium onion, diced Adds great flavor and crunch.
  • 1 packet taco seasoning Feel free to use homemade if preferred.
  • 1 cup cooked rice You can use brown rice for more fiber.
  • 1 cup black beans, drained and rinsed Adds protein and fiber.
  • 1 cup corn, frozen or canned Optional, but adds sweetness.
  • 1 cup cheddar cheese, shredded Feel free to substitute with your favorite cheese.
  • 1 cup sour cream Can be replaced with Greek yogurt for a healthier option.
  • 0.5 cup fresh cilantro, chopped Garnish for added freshness.

Instructions

Preparation Steps

  • In a large skillet over medium heat, brown the ground beef along with the diced onion. Break the meat apart as it cooks until it’s no longer pink.
  • Once the beef is cooked, drain any excess fat and add the taco seasoning. Mix in about 1/2 cup of water, bringing it to a simmer. Let it cook for about 5 minutes until the flavors meld.
  • Prepare bowls by layering the cooked rice, followed by the seasoned beef mixture, black beans, and corn. Top with shredded cheese, sour cream, and cilantro.
  • Serve immediately and enjoy customizing your bowls with any extra toppings you love!

Notes

Feel free to customize these taco bowls with your favorite toppings like avocado, salsa, or jalapeños for an extra kick!
